    The instrument at the beginning and in the background through the song is the shamisen which has 3 strings. The title of the song is a combination of "metal" and "matsuri" which are Japanese summer festivals that involve dancing and people wearing the masks that are shown in the video. The lyrics encourage everyone to dance and the shouts of "sore" and "wasshoi" are sort of like "heave ho" and "let's go". In the little kabuki break by Momoko she says that we are all idiots so we should all dance.

    At JAPANESE FESTIVALS, you will often see a group of people carry portable shrines on their shoulders. They shout "Wasshoi Wasshoi... " endlessly as they move about. Usually they are carried by men, but in respect to BABYMETAL, here is a female group => ruclips.net/video/dknY49pINvo/видео.html Also the main message at festivals are repeated in this MV = There are two types of idiots. one that dances and one that watches. If you're going to be an idiot (by being here) be the dancing idiot. So this song was designed to have people dance and shout. This will be totally wild live.

The repetitive わっしょい "Wasshoi" is a call or yell used in Japanese Matsuri (festival). It is a kind of phrase to intensify people's excitement and especially to encourage the power of guys who are carrying a heavy Mikoshi that is similar to a float in Western style festivals.
